Electronic examination method for surface layer of soft-elastic materials involves determining elastic and viscoplastic material constants based on size and structure of supporting real area, form of test body, and value of admitting force

摘要

The method involves determining the elastic and viscoplastic material constants based on the size and structure of the supporting real area, the form of a test body, the value of the admitting force, and the service life under load. The nominal area preset by a test body with respect to supporting real area and the faulty area is measured using microelectronic contact sensors. An independent claim is also included for an electronic examination device.
